So, What Exactly Is Snap-8?

At its core, Snap-8 is an octapeptide. That just means it's a chain of eight amino acids linked together. But its power lies in its structure. It's engineered to be a biomimetic peptide, meaning it mimics a natural biological component. Specifically, it imitates the N-terminal end of a protein called SNAP-25. Simple, right?

Well, the implications are profound. SNAP-25 is a critical player in the SNARE complex, the molecular machinery responsible for releasing neurotransmitters (like acetylcholine) at the neuromuscular junction. When a nerve wants to tell a muscle to contract, this complex has to form perfectly. Think of it like a tiny, biological docking station. Now, this is where it gets interesting. Because Snap-8 looks so much like a piece of that docking station, it can compete for a spot. It gets in the way. It destabilizes the SNARE complex, making it less efficient. The result? The signal for muscle contraction is attenuated. It’s muted. The muscle doesn't contract as forcefully, and the overlying skin remains smoother. Snap-8 vs. Argireline: The Peptide Showdown

Anyone looking for the best Snap-8 for forehead lines will inevitably encounter its famous predecessor, Argireline (Acetyl Hexapeptide-8). They come from the same family and share a similar mechanism, but they aren't identical. Understanding the distinctions is key to making an informed decision for your research.

Argireline is a hexapeptide (six amino acids), while Snap-8 is an octapeptide (eight amino acids). Both work by interfering with the SNARE complex. However, the addition of two amino acids in Snap-8 is believed to enhance its ability to disrupt the complex, leading to a more pronounced muscle-relaxing effect in laboratory studies. It’s an evolution of the original concept. First, demand a Certificate of Analysis (COA). And not just any COA. It should be from a reputable third-party lab and show purity data from High-Performance Liquid Chromatography (HPLC) and Mass Spectrometry (MS). HPLC separates the components of the sample, showing a primary peak for the correct peptide and smaller (or nonexistent) peaks for impurities. MS confirms that the primary peak has the correct molecular weight, verifying the amino acid sequence is right. If a supplier can't provide this, walk away. It's that simple. Another pitfall is the expectation of instant results. Snap-8 is not a filler that plumps a line immediately. Its mechanism is gradual. It works by reducing the intensity of muscle contractions over time, allowing the skin to relax and smooth out. In a research context, this means studies need to be designed with an appropriate timeline, often spanning several weeks, to observe the full effect. Anyone promising an overnight transformation misunderstands the fundamental biology at play. Let’s be honest, this is crucial. Patience and consistent application are key.

Finally, there's a tendency to see it as a magic bullet. Snap-8 is an incredibly powerful tool for addressing dynamic wrinkles caused by muscle movement. However, it doesn't address static wrinkles (lines that are present at rest) caused by collagen loss or sun damage. Snap-8 works topically by destabilizing the SNARE complex to gently reduce muscle contractions. In contrast, botulinum toxin is an injectable that works by cleaving the SNAP-25 protein, effectively blocking neurotransmitter release more completely. They share a target pathway but have vastly different potencies and methods of administration.

The SNARE complex is essential for releasing the neurotransmitter acetylcholine, which signals the frontalis muscle in the forehead to contract. Repeated contractions fold the skin, creating lines. By interfering with this complex, Snap-8 helps reduce the intensity of those contractions.
In most study protocols, observable effects on dynamic wrinkles begin to appear after about 14 days of consistent application, with more significant results typically noted after 28-30 days. It is not an immediate effect, as it works by gradually relaxing the underlying muscle expression over time.
